10/29/2023 0 Comments Dual compartment makeup bag![]() We could fit pretty much everything in this thing: a whopping seven palettes, a whole brush collection, two foundation bottles, five toiletry bottles, over 15 lipsticks, an eyelash curler, hair spray, and a travel-sized moisturizer bottle, to be exact. While this case is on the larger side, we felt that ended up being more helpful than hurtful while traveling. It does take up a bit of space in your luggage. The Details: 9.5 x 4 x 7 inches | PU leather, nylon, PVC, poly | Zipper closure You can grab the case in eight colors ranging from beige to berry. Though $68 may feel a bit pricey for a makeup bag, we felt this case’s thoughtful design and durable construction is worth it. ![]() And speaking of the interior, the bag actually boasts a large attached mirror on the inside, which comes in handy for in-transit makeup application.ĭuring our tests, the PU leather and hardware worked together to create efficient padding that kept the contents of the case safe and intact through bumps and drops - not to mention, the bag itself still looked good through the wear and tear. We also noticed that, because the interior of the case is so roomy, it’s incredibly easy to see every item inside when fully opened. There are even multiple additional pockets, pouches, and subtle slots in the bag, so there’s truly a place for everything. ![]() The main compartment opens and closes smoothly, while a center compartment for brushes and other smaller items can be removed in a snap. Reliable, stylish, and compact yet spacious, it’s no wonder this easy-to-pack cosmetic case from luggage brand Béis impressed us the most. We feel it could benefit from interior straps to hold products down.
